VACANCY: Business Development Executive

Walker Humphrey are looking for an enthusiastic Business Development Executive to work for our well-established family owned and managed distribution company based near Sherburn in Elmet, Leeds. You will be working as part of a team , where high quality standards are implemented throughout the business.

Helping to achieve and maintain our culture of friendly and excellent customer service, by taking personal responsibility and ownership of always delivering to the highest possible standards in all areas to all of our customers.

Main Roles & Responsibilities:

  1. Responsibility for the company’s portfolio of clients.
  2. Develop new business by means of report analysis working closely with the Sales Manager.
  3. Helping to develop and retain good customer relations and generate additional sales leads from existing customers.
  4. Responsibility for arranging monthly meetings with Sales Manager to discuss product opportunities and identify any service or quality issues, including buying trends that have changed.
  5. Handling customer complaints and queries in accordance with the company’s BRCGS guidelines and policies.
  6. Working closely with Customer Services / Telesales to assist with product information, pricing and out of stock items to ensure customers receive possible alternative options on time for their delivery day.
  7. Responsibility for selling of the company’s products and services by providing product and service information, including promotional offers and new product launches.
  8. Working closely with key suppliers to help maintain and build new business, ensuring that technical assistance and rebates are provided for appropriate customers.
  9. Producing customer quotations, ensuring agreed prices are communicated effectively and in a timely manner.
  10. Liaising closely with the Operations & Commercial Directors, ensuring sales and gross margins are regularly reviewed and kept in line with company targets, monthly actions are agreed and followed up on.
  11. Actively participating in and promoting the product safety, legality and quality culture of the business throughout all aspects of my day-to-day role.
  12. Working as part of a team in a friendly and professional manner.
